itecopeople have been exclusively retained by Parnall Bio Engineering Limited, part of the Parnall Group, which is a unique and pioneering Group of Companies to appoint an experienced and entrepreneurial Project Leader to champion a pre-revenue project through product development and commercialisation of a new modular building technology.

The new to market product is a structural bio-composite panel system that utilises natural materials and includes integrated renewable energy technology. This factory fabricated system is intended for application across broad residential and commercial build programmes.
